MET values “do not estimate the energy cost of physical activity in individuals in ways that account for differences in body mass, adiposity, age, sex, efficiency of movement, geographic and environmental conditions in which the activities are performed. A task with a MET of 10 uses 10 times as much energy as a task with a MET of 1. You can find an activity’s MET on the chart above.Ī task with a MET of 1 is roughly equal to a person’s energy expenditure from sitting still at room temperature not actively digesting food.Ī task with a MET of 2 uses twice as much energy as a task with a MET of 1. “MET” is a measurement of the energy cost of physical activity for a period of time. How many calories are burned from yoga? FormulaĬalories burned per minute = (MET x body weight in Kg x 3.5) ÷ 200 ![]()
